u-blox Holding AG announced that 2019 will see some changes in the Board of Directors. Prof. Dr. Gerhard Troster and Dr. Paul Van Iseghem will retire and therefore not stand for re-election at the upcoming Annual General Assembly on April 25, 2019. Both have been instrumental over many years in the development of the company: Prof. Dr. Gerhard Troster as founding professor since u-blox was spun off from the ETH, and Dr. Paul van Iseghem as Vice-Chairman since 2011. The board will propose the election of the following candidates as non-executive director on the Board of Directors of u-blox Holding AG: Dr. Annette Rinck and Markus Borchert. As previously announced, Daniel Ammann, member of the Executive Committee and responsible for the Positioning and Short-Range Radio product centers, will leave u-blox at the end of March 2019 and the Executive Committee was reorganized to combine all product centers in one group, which will be headed by Andreas Thiel. Mr. Thiel is member of the Executive Committee, as well as being a co-founder of u-blox, and is currently responsible for the Cellular product center and the center for integrated circuits.
